I have a friend who bought the Autotech fuel module and loves it. He has an 87 16v stock except for a turbo pushing 6psi. He said in the upper RPMs there was a definite 'seat of the pants' difference. I personally have no experience with such mod, but I do know it can be built cheaply and easily for about 1/5th of what the companies are asking for it.
 
Dan
PS- These modules are adjustable in some fashion right? I think I remember hearing you could adjust the amount of fueling with a little dial.
